J'utilise un UITextView et je suis confus à propos de la disparition du clavier. Dois-je utiliser une sorte de notification pour le faire disparaître? MerciComment faire disparaître le KeyBoard lors de l'utilisation d'UITextView dans l'iPhone
0
A
Répondre
1
Ce n'est pas très intuitif, mais tout ce que vous avez à faire est de mettre en œuvre l'événement doneButtonOnKeyboardPressed
dans votre contrôleur de vue. Vous n'avez en fait rien à faire dans le gestionnaire d'événements, le simple fait de le faire provoquera la disparition du clavier après que l'utilisateur ait tapé sur "Terminé".
Un gestionnaire vide ressemblera à quelque chose comme ceci:
- (IBAction) doneButtonOnKeyboardPressed:(id)sender {
}
Questions connexes
- 1. Faire disparaître le curseur
- 2. Comment faire disparaître un composant dans le concepteur de formulaires?
- 3. Comment faire disparaître la bordure de DecoratedTabPanel?
- 4. Faire disparaître un contrôleur de vue
- 5. Faire disparaître les barres de défilement dans PerformancePoint Strategy Map
- 6. vc80.pdb - Comment puis-je le faire disparaître et ne plus me déranger?
- 7. KeyBoard Stroke Events
- 8. Delphi Keyboard Hook
- 9. ReSharper Keyboard Map
- 10. ASP.NET C# événement OnMouseOver pour faire apparaître ListBox et disparaître
- 11. Qwerty Keyboard en HTML
- 12. Faire disparaître une info-bulle fixe en faisant défiler
- 13. Comment lier ESC à keyboard-escape-quit dans Emacs?
- 14. Comment empêcher les dessins dans un contexte UIView de disparaître?
- 15. Cocoa Touch - UISearchBar Keyboard - Masquer le bouton 'Search'
- 16. Qu'est-ce qui pourrait faire disparaître les cookies de session en cours de session?
- 17. Utilisation de javascript pour faire disparaître une image en dégradé de gris à couleur
- 18. Le moyen le plus simple d'empêcher tous les threads Java de disparaître dans IO?
- 19. Erreur lors de l'utilisation Faire
- 20. Comment faire un ou sélectionner lors de l'utilisation de subsonic?
- 21. Comment faire pour inverser les coordonnées lors du dessin dans le contexte?
- 22. Comment faire pour supprimer le code de débogage lors de la compilation en C++?
- 23. jQuery hover: disparaître dans un div caché tout en effaçant le "par défaut" un
- 24. Comment faire pour pointer le html cible lors de la transformation xml?
- 25. column.OptionsFilter.ImmediateUpdateAutoFilter comment le définir lors de l'exécution
- 26. Comment faire pivoter l'image dans le compteur de vitesse?
- 27. Comment faire pour arrêter le texte dans le tableau HTML
- 28. problème de commandes manuelles, plus de 10 produits dans une commande laissera l'ordre disparaître (oscommerce)
- 29. Comment réduire le scintillement dans IE lors de la publication?
- 30. Comment faire pour obtenir ContentType pour le fichier dans ASP.NET MVC lors de l'utilisation de fichier Action Méthode
Hey Merci pour la réponse. Ça a marché. Vous avez mentionné que ce n'est pas très intuitif. Pouvez-vous s'il vous plaît dire s'il existe un autre contrôle que je peux utiliser pour l'entrée de ligne multiple dans l'iPhone. Merci – felix
Non, c'est à peu près ce que nous sommes coincés avec. Il y a beaucoup de choses sur le SDK iPhone qui ne sont pas vraiment intuitif. –
Une question connexe est: comment puis-je faire apparaître la touche "Terminé" sur mon clavier? Je ne semble pas en avoir un. – MusiGenesis